Three angry young men: Negro Catholics speak on the rising mood of anger among the Negro leaders & the Negro community.
Paul Twine, Albert Ransone, and Mike Lawson discuss their experiences and thoughts on being African American Catholics in Chicago, Ill. at a NCCIJ traveling workshop held at Mundelein College in Chicago.
